Technical Overview
This graphics card leverages NVIDIA's GeForce RTX architecture, featuring 6144 CUDA cores for parallel processing tasks. The 12 GB GDDR7 memory operates with a 192-bit bus width, balancing capacity and speed for gaming, content creation, and simulation applications.
Connectivity includes three DisplayPort and two HDMI outputs, allowing flexible multi-display configurations. The card requires a 750 W power supply and uses a single 16-pin power connector. It supports OpenGL 4.6 API and includes AI-powered features for enhanced performance in supported applications.

Physical Profile
The card features a triple-slot design with dimensions of 12.95" (329 mm) in length, 5.51" (140 mm) in width, and 2.46" (62.50 mm) in height. This form factor requires adequate chassis space and a triple-slot PCIe area for installation. The fan cooler ensures efficient heat dissipation within this compact yet performance-oriented footprint.

FAQ
What is the memory capacity and type on this graphics card?
This TUF graphics card includes 12 GB of GDDR7 memory. GDDR7 is a high-speed memory technology that provides increased bandwidth compared to previous generations, which helps in handling large textures, high-resolution frame buffers, and complex graphical data efficiently during gaming or professional rendering tasks.
What PCIe interface does this card use, and what are the benefits?
The card uses a PCI Express 5.0 x16 interface. PCIe 5.0 offers double the bandwidth per lane compared to PCIe 4.0, reducing potential bottlenecks in data transfer between the GPU and the system. This is particularly beneficial for high-frame-rate gaming, data-intensive simulations, and applications that require rapid access to large datasets.
How many displays can I connect, and what resolutions are supported?
You can connect up to four monitors simultaneously. The card supports a maximum digital display resolution of 7680 x 4320 (8K), making it suitable for ultra-high-definition gaming, content creation, and multi-monitor setups for trading, monitoring, or productivity workflows.
What cooling solution does this graphics card feature?
It features a triple-fan cooler designed to dissipate heat effectively. This cooling system helps maintain optimal GPU temperatures during extended use, reducing thermal throttling and ensuring consistent performance. The fans are power-efficient, contributing to quieter operation and longer component lifespan.
What power supply is required for this graphics card?
A 750 W power supply is recommended to ensure stable operation. The card uses a single 16-pin power connector. Adequate power is crucial for supporting the GPU's performance peaks, especially during intensive gaming or rendering sessions, and helps prevent system instability.
What are the physical dimensions, and will it fit in my case?
The card measures 12.95 inches in length, 5.51 inches in width, and 2.46 inches in height, requiring a triple-slot PCIe space. Before purchasing, verify that your computer case has sufficient clearance in length and width, and that the motherboard has an available triple-slot area to accommodate this form factor.
